Output 2ee4214043ae7ae8b2540addedee49ebcd63062dfbe41768d8db1e5cbd17ed27:3

value
84253258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26f60b748816c82154950fe8e9bbaefc372956e7 OP_EQUAL
address
MBTAfD3WxcrftEreUAQNoaL1tLGr1k2UFq
transaction
2ee4214043ae7ae8b2540addedee49ebcd63062dfbe41768d8db1e5cbd17ed27
spent
true